Dodge Lady Warriors split region games
By Russ Ragan
The Dodge Middle School Lady Warriors split a couple of region games this past week. They dropped a very tough 3-2 game at Bleckley County. Dodge rallied to take a 21-13 win over East Laurens. Dodge will host Swainsboro this Thursday in the season’s final regular season game at 4:00 p.m.
Here are the stats from last week’s play. At Bleckley County, Ava Rowland was one for three with a double and a run scored; Makiyah Roberson was one for three, a run scored and a stolen base; Annie Jones was two for three with a run batted in (RBI); JaiunaVae Pattillo had an RBI and Brooke Perdue pitched really well in the game with nine strikeouts.
Against East Laurens, Dylana Barton had a walk and three runs scored; JaiunaVae Pattillo had a single and four runs scored; Jayci Yawn had a walk; Annie Jones had a homer, a walk, four runs scored, two stolen bases and three RBI’s.
Makiyah Roberson was two for two, had two walks and two runs scored; Brooke Perdue had a single, two runs scored and was the winning pitcher in the game; Ava Maxwell had two walks, two runs scored and an RBI; Reagan Boney had a walk and a run scored; Ava Rowland had a single, a stolen base and two runs scored and Carsen Etheridge had two walks and two runs scored.

Lady Indians are undefeated in the region
By Russ Ragan
It was a huge week for the Dodge County High Lady Indians Softball team. They had four big region matchups, including a big showdown last Monday at Bleckley County. The game was the battle everyone expected, as the lead swung both ways. Dodge trailed 5-4 going into the seventh. The Lady Indians got off the deck and scored four runs in the seventh for a huge 8-5 win.
The rest of the week also included region matchups. Tuesday, September 19, 2017, Dodge defeated Washington County 12-0. Northeast Macon came to town on Wednesday to makeup a rained out game, and Dodge rolled to a 20-0 win. The Lady Indians finished the week up with a 13-2 road win at East Laurens. The game had a late conclusion due to weather delays.
There was a big crowd in Cochran for the huge region matchup. Jade Dowdy got the start on the mound for the Lady Indians. She got off to a strong start, as she had three strikeouts through the first two innings. The game was scoreless going into the third. With one out, Julianna Bellflower walked, Jade Dowdy reached on an error and Aniyah Black walked, to load the bases. With two out, Jacey Dowdy hit a double that unloaded the bases to give Dodge a 3-0 lead. The Lady Royals got a pair of runs back in the fourth to cut the Dodge lead to 3-2.
Dodge picked up a run in the sixth, as Amber Maxwell singled home Abby Manning for a 4-2 Dodge lead. Bleckley would charge back in its half of the sixth. They would score three unearned runs to take a 5-4 lead going to the seventh inning.
Dodge would be at the top of the order in the seventh. Bellflower would lead off with a walk. The Lady Indians would then get a big break, as Bleckley threw away a potential double play ball, and that put runners on first and second with nobody out. A walk to Black would be her third of the game, and the bases were loaded with nobody out. Manning would single home Bellflower to tie the game at 5-5. Jacey Dowdy would then get her third hit and fourth run batted in (RBI) that scored Sydney Powell, who was running for Jade Dowdy to give Dodge a 6-5 lead. Dodge would then get huge insurance runs on RBI’s from Sara Lann and Hailey Hickman, and Dodge would have an 8-5 lead going to the bottom of the seventh.
The Lady Royals would make one final stand, as they got a pair of base runners with two out. A harmless ground ball to Manning at third would end the wild game and give the Lady Indians a huge 8-5 win.
Dodge would host Washington County on Tuesday, September 19, 2017, in another big region contest. Freshman Linzy Bowen got the start on the mound. She picked up a pair of strikeouts to start the day. Bellflower walked and Jenna Hickman would reach on an error. They both stole a base to set up Black. She would single both runners in for a 2-0 Dodge lead.
An error and a wild pitch later would have her at third, and Manning would drive her in for a 3-0 Dodge lead. Hailey Hickman would double home Europe Brown, who was running for Jacey Dowdy who walked, and Dodge had a 4-0 lead after the first.
Bowen got another pair of strikeouts in the second and third. The Lady Indians would add to the lead in the third. With one out, Manning reached on an error, and Jacey Dowdy walked. Hailey Hickman singled home Manning, and Maxwell drove in Brown, who was running for Jacey Dowdy, and the Dodge lead was 6-0. Bowen got the side out in order in the fourth, thanks to a rare 5-6-4 double play turned by Manning, Black and Bellflower.
Dodge would put the game away in the home half of the fourth. Bellflower would be hit by a pitch to lead off. Powell would single and advance to third on an error, as Bellflower would score for a 7-0 Dodge lead. Black would single home Powell for an 8-0 game. The lead would be 9-0, and after a walk by Gracie Lewis and a Lann single, Jade Dowdy would pinch-hit a three-run homer that just got over the left field fence for a 12-0 lead, and that would end the game. Bowen would finish up with a no-hitter and seven strikeouts.
On Wednesday, September 20, Dodge would host Northeast Macon. This game got completely out of hand from the start. Dodge would draw 14 walks in the game, including eight in the first inning alone. Lann would pitch a one-hit shutout with six strikeouts in the 20-0 blowout. The game could have actually been much worse, if not for the fact that Dodge made four of their six outs on purpose.
Here is a stat rundown of the game. Bellflower was two for two with three runs scored, two walks and two stolen bases; Jade Dowdy was one for one with two walks, three runs scored, two RBI’s and a stolen base; Black was two for two with a double and a triple, three runs scored and three RBI’s; Manning was one for one with two runs scored, a stolen base, two RBI’s and two walks; Lann had two walks, two runs scored and three RBI’s; Powell had two walks, two runs scored and two RBI’s and Bowen was two for three with a run scored, a stolen base and four RBI’s.
The Lady Indians would wrap up their busy week with a road game at East Laurens. Dodge jumped out early in this one. Bellflower would walk, Jade Dowdy would reach on an error and Black would single to load the bases with nobody out. A single from Manning would give Dodge a 1-0 lead. Jacey Dowdy would drive in Powell, who was running for Jade Dowdy, and Black for a 3-0 Dodge lead. Lann would knock in Manning with a single for a 4-0 lead. Bellflower would single home the final run of the inning for a 6-0 Dodge game after the top of the first.
Jade Dowdy got the start on the mound for the Lady Indians. The Lady Falcons got a couple of runs back in the bottom of the second, and the Dodge lead was 6-2.
Dodge would answer back in the third. The Lady Indians got a pair of RBI’s from Black and Manning, and the lead was back to 8-2.
Dodge added to the lead in the fourth. With two out, Maxwell doubled, and she would score on a single from Jenna Hickman for a 9-2 lead. The lead remained 9-2 going into the seventh on a stormy night. Maxwell singled and stole second. She scored on a single from Bellflower for a 10-2 game.
A two-out single from Black scored Bellflower for an 11-2 game. Manning would triple to score Black, and she would score on an error for a 13-2 lead. Dodge had to sit through a weather delay in the bottom of the seventh but had no problem, as the final would be 13-2.

Dodge slams Southwest 38-14
By David Bush
Well sports fans, region play is finally here. This is the part of the schedule where every game counts towards our playoff hopes. Most teams do not want to start region play with Southwest Macon. This team beat us in a war over there in Macon last season. They also tied Washington County (Waco) for the best record in the region last year, but lost to Washington County head-to-head, giving Waco the region championship.
This team features a quarterback, #11 Jordan Slocum, who is listed at six foot, five inches tall (I think he’s taller than that) and 215 pounds, and middle linebacker #9 Randy Green at six foot, one inch tall and 230 pounds #9 Green was a first team Class AA all-state selection last season. Needless to say, our Indians were going to have to bring their “A” game to play with these big boys.
To start the game, Dodge lost the coin toss (first one we’ve lost this season), so Southwest used one of ole Rex Hodge’s tricks and deferred to the second half. Southwest kicked the ball off to #2 R.J. Carr, who returned the ball to the Dodge 35-yard line. Our offense took over and picked up a first down out to the 45-yard line. There, on first and ten from the 45-yard line, #2 Carr shot through the Patriot defense for a 55-yard touchdown run. #19 Peyton Bush tacked on the extra point and just like that, Dodge was on top 7-0 early in the game.
After the kickoff, the Indian defense held the Patriots to a three and out series and forced a punt.
The Dodge offense took over at their own 18-yard line. #27 Erin Pitts carried the ball for 9 yards, and then #11 Nick Cummings hit #20 KeAnthony Woods on a nice pass to set up first and ten at the Dodge 29-yard line. On the next play, #2 Carr got loose and sprinted 68 yards before being caught on about the 4-yard line of Southwest. Three plays later, #2 Carr carried the ball into the end-zone for ”Another Dodge County Touchdown,” as announcer Quint Bush would say. The point after by #19 Bush was true, and the scoreboard changed to 14-0 Indians with six minutes 12 seconds to go in the first quarter.
After a Dodge kickoff and nice tackle by the kicker #19 Bush, Southwest set up for their next attempt at finding the end-zone. The Indian defense, which has been tough all year, forced another three and out.
The Patriots punted the ball back to Dodge and three plays later, Dodge was punting the ball back to the Patriots. #19 Bush connected on a 40-yard punt to get the ball out of Dodge territory. So, on the following possession, Southwest, on third and 13, tried to pass their way down the field, only to have #20 Woods intercept the throw and return the ball to midfield. The Indians marched down the field with hard runs by the firm of #2 Carr, #16 Cummings and #27 Pitts. On first and goal from the 5-yard line, #2 Carr walked in for his third touchdown of the game. #19 Bush again was good on the extra point attempt, and the score was 21-0 with ten minutes 33 seconds to go in the second quarter.
The Patriots, starting at their own 20-yard line, due to an unreturnable kick by #19 Bush, began to move the ball down the field. Southwest put together an 11 play, and one ridiculous penalty on Dodge, drive to go 80 yards and get into the end-zone for their first touchdown. The Patriots went for two on the extra point but were unsuccessful making the score 21-6 with six minutes 24 seconds left in the second quarter.
On the ensuing Southwest kickoff, future phenom #1 Daylon Gordon, returned the ball to the 30-yard line of Dodge. The Indians offense wasted little time getting right back down the field before stalling at the 6-yard line of Southwest. #19 Bush and the field goal team were called on to come in and convert on a 23-yard field goal and increased the score to 24-6 with one minute two seconds left in the half. Dodge would stifle the Patriot offense for the next 62 seconds and the half ended.
The halftime shows by both bands were very entertaining. The Marching Chiefs, who sounded great, were also accompanied by the middle school band and some fine young dancers from the Georgia Peach Dance Team, “The Dodge County Dazzlers.” We are very fortunate to have such a talented group of performers in our community. If your kids are not currently involved in another activity and would like to be a part of something that is growing and really exciting, I would encourage you to get them involved in band or one of the drill teams. They won’t be sorry.
The second half started with another touchback by kicker #19 Bush. The two teams spent much of the third quarter in a defensive battle, trading possessions and field position until, with three minutes 26 seconds left in the third quarter, the Patriots found the end-zone on a 32-yard pass play. Their two-point conversion was good, and now the score was 24-14 Dodge.
On the following kickoff, #27 Pitts took the ball all the way out to the Patriot 48-yard line. Dodge was unable to take advantage of the good field position, and the Dodge drive was halted at the Patriot 25-yard line on a fourth and one play.
Momentum seemed to be turning in favor of Southwest. In just three plays, the Patriots were threatening, when Indian #35 big Jadin Johnson got in the backfield and chased the quarterback all the way back to the Southwest 28-yard line before slamming him to the turf for a HUGE defensive play.
On second and 43, the defense again came up big and forced a fumble. Dodge pounced on the ball, and we were back in business. On the Indians’ second play from scrimmage #27 Pitts exploded up the middle for a 25-yard touchdown. #19 Bush came in and added the extra point, and Dodge had put out the fire, increasing the lead to 31-14 with nine minutes 47 seconds to go in the game.
On the next Patriot possession, on a third and four play, the Dodge defense flushed the quarterback out of the pocket, forcing a desperation pass that was intercepted by #45 Tyler Ruffin, who raced 35 yards untouched to the end-zone for an apparent touchdown. But the flag fairy paid us a visit again, and the ball was brought back to the Patriot 37-yard line. Eight plays later, #16 Cummings ran the ball in from two yards out, and #19 Bush kicked his fifth extra point of the night to make the score 38-14.
The reserves would be brought in for both teams to finish out the game with about four minutes 50 seconds to go in the game. Neither team would score again, and the game would end 38-14 Dodge.
This was a big region win for our Indians and next week we will have to bring our “A” game again. As for this week, boys, I give you an A+.
The game statistics, courtesy of Jay Mullis, were as follows. Dodge County had 17 first downs to Southwest’s ten. The Indians had 326 total rushing yards, while Southwest had 73. Dodge had 27 passing yards to Southwest’s 172. In total offense, the Indians had 353 yards to Southwest’s 245. In scoring and rushing totals, #2 Carr had 202 yards on 20 carries and three touchdowns. #27 Pitts had 86 yards on 12 carries and one touchdown. #16 Cummings had 35 yards on 15 carries and one touchdown, #1 Gordon had three yards on two carries and #19 Bush was five for five on extra point attempts and one for one on a 23-yard field-goal.
Next week the game will be against a much-improved Northeast Macon team in Macon.
Everyone that can make the trip, please come and support our Indians. Dodge County always brings a huge crowd, and it really makes a difference. We’ll see you there.

Two killed in wreck
A man and woman were killed when the 18 wheeler they were in ran into a Dodge County trash truck. The accident happened at approximately 11:23 a.m. on Tuesday, September 26 at the intersection of the Chauncey Rhine Highway and the Milan Eastman Highway at Mt. Ararat Church. It appeared that the trash truck was headed toward Milan on the Milan Eastman Highway and failed to yield the right of way to the 18 wheel truck that was headed toward Chauncey on the Chauncey Rhine Highway at the stop sign at the intersection of the two roads. The man driving the 18 wheeler and a woman passenger were killed. The driver of the trash truck was injured and was taken to Dodge County Hospital by Dodge County Emergency Medical Services (EMS). The 18 wheel truck had a Randall Stubbs Trucking, Inc. logo on the door. The names of the deceased were not given out due to next of kin being notified. Dodge County EMS, the Chauncey Fire Department, the Milan Fire Department, Dodge County Sheriff’s deputies and the Georgia State Patrol responded to the accident. Full details of the wreck were not available from the Georgia State Patrol as of presstime. (Photo by Chuck Eckles)
